AnyParser features and specs

  • Versatility
    AnyParser can handle a wide variety of data formats and structures, making it a flexible tool for parsing diverse data sources.
  • Ease of Use
    The platform offers a user-friendly interface and clear documentation, which simplifies the process of integrating and deploying parsers in applications.
  • Customization
    Users can easily customize the parsing rules to fit their specific needs, allowing for precise data extraction and manipulation.
  • Scalability
    AnyParser is designed to handle large volumes of data efficiently, making it suitable for enterprise-level applications that require processing big data.

Possible disadvantages of AnyParser

  • Cost
    As a commercial product, AnyParser may represent a significant cost, particularly for smaller businesses or individual developers.
  • Learning Curve
    Although it is user-friendly, there may still be a learning curve for those unfamiliar with data parsing or the specific functionalities of the platform.
  • Dependency
    Relying on a third-party service can be a limitation, especially if there are service outages, changes in service terms, or the company discontinues the product.
  • Integration Limitations
    Integration with legacy systems or very specific, uncommon data formats might require additional effort or could face compatibility issues.

Analysis of AnyParser

Overall verdict

  • AnyParser by CambioML is a solid document parsing solution that uses AI to accurately extract structured data from complex documents like PDFs, images, and scanned files, making it a good choice for teams needing reliable, high-accuracy extraction.

Why this product is good

  • Uses advanced AI and LLM-based technology to accurately parse complex layouts, tables, and unstructured content
  • Handles a variety of document formats including PDFs, images, and scanned documents
  • Preserves document structure and layout for more usable output
  • Offers API access that makes it easy to integrate into existing data pipelines and applications
  • Focuses on privacy and secure handling of sensitive documents
  • Reduces manual data entry and speeds up document processing workflows

Recommended for

  • Developers building applications that require automated document data extraction
  • Businesses processing large volumes of invoices, receipts, or forms
  • Teams working with RAG pipelines and needing clean data for LLM applications
  • Financial, legal, and healthcare organizations handling complex or sensitive documents
  • Data engineers automating ETL workflows involving unstructured documents
